require 'spec_helper'
describe Gitlab::Metrics::UnicornSampler do
subject { described_class.new(1.second) }
describe '#sample' do
let(:unicorn) { double('unicorn') }
let(:raindrops) { double('raindrops') }
let(:stats) { double('stats') }
before do
stub_const('Unicorn', unicorn)
stub_const('Raindrops::Linux', raindrops)
allow(raindrops).to receive(:unix_listener_stats).and_return({})
allow(raindrops).to receive(:tcp_listener_stats).and_return({})
end
context 'unicorn listens on unix sockets' do
let(:socket_address) { '/some/sock' }
let(:sockets) { [socket_address] }
before do
allow(unicorn).to receive(:listener_names).and_return(sockets)
end
it 'samples socket data' do
expect(raindrops).to receive(:unix_listener_stats).with(sockets)
subject.sample
end
context 'stats collected' do
before do
allow(stats).to receive(:active).and_return('active')
allow(stats).to receive(:queued).and_return('queued')
allow(raindrops).to receive(:unix_listener_stats).and_return({ socket_address => stats })
end
it 'updates metrics type unix and with addr' do
labels = { type: 'unix', address: socket_address }
expect(subject).to receive_message_chain(:unicorn_active_connections, :set).with(labels, 'active')
expect(subject).to receive_message_chain(:unicorn_queued_connections, :set).with(labels, 'queued')
subject.sample
end
end
end
context 'unicorn listens on tcp sockets' do
let(:tcp_socket_address) { '0.0.0.0:8080' }
let(:tcp_sockets) { [tcp_socket_address] }
before do
allow(unicorn).to receive(:listener_names).and_return(tcp_sockets)
end
it 'samples socket data' do
expect(raindrops).to receive(:tcp_listener_stats).with(tcp_sockets)
subject.sample
end
context 'stats collected' do
before do
allow(stats).to receive(:active).and_return('active')
allow(stats).to receive(:queued).and_return('queued')
allow(raindrops).to receive(:tcp_listener_stats).and_return({ tcp_socket_address => stats })
end
it 'updates metrics type unix and with addr' do
labels = { type: 'tcp', address: tcp_socket_address }
expect(subject).to receive_message_chain(:unicorn_active_connections, :set).with(labels, 'active')
expect(subject).to receive_message_chain(:unicorn_queued_connections, :set).with(labels, 'queued')
subject.sample
end
end
end
end
describe '#start' do
context 'when enabled' do
before do
allow(subject).to receive(:enabled?).and_return(true)
end
it 'creates new thread' do
expect(Thread).to receive(:new)
subject.start
end
end
context 'when disabled' do
before do
allow(subject).to receive(:enabled?).and_return(false)
end
it "doesn't create new thread" do
expect(Thread).not_to receive(:new)
subject.start
end
end
end
end
